1. 7th Illinois Infantry Marker
Inscription.
U.S.
Army of the Tennessee.
7th Illinois Infantry,
Sweeny's (3d) Brigade,
W.H.L. Wallace's (2d) Division.

This regiment was engaged here at about 10 A.M. April 7, 1862.
 
Erected by Shiloh National Military Park Commission. (Marker Number 93.)
